Doxa AB (DOXA) — Working Capital to Net Assets Ratio

Latest as of September 2025: 109.6%

Doxa AB (DOXA) has a Working Capital to Net Assets ratio of 109.6% as of September 2025. Working capital of Skr2.27 Billion (current assets of Skr2.83 Billion minus current liabilities of Skr560.20 Million) is measured against net assets of Skr2.07 Billion. A higher ratio indicates strong short-term liquidity financed by the equity base. See net asset quality index of Doxa AB to measure how much of total assets are equity-financed.
